Togo vs Rwanda Prediction: African Nations Match on 26.01.2021

Tuesday brings another eye-catching round of matches for football fans to enjoy with major leagues backed up by the African Nations schedule. In this article, our team of sports experts focus their attention on Togo vs Rwanda in the hope of predicting a winner.

An interesting side note to this game is Togo and Rwanda have never faced off in competitive action with Tuesday’s game being the first recorded meeting. That means both teams will be eager to get off to a winning start and write their names into the history books.

Togo former quartet finalists

The Sparrowhawks are currently as low as 128th in the world according to FIFA and that should give casual followers of this competition an idea of what to expect from Togo. They were once as high as 46th in the world but that effort was back in the summer of 2006. Since then we’ve seen Togo continue to fall down the list.

They have played only once in the World Cup, eliminated at the group stage in 2006 but have fared much better in the African Nations, qualifying eight times already. Their best effort so far came in 2013 when Togo made it all the way to the quarter-finals.  A repeat of that run isn’t beyond them, but it would be a big ask.

Rwanda have qualified once before

A check on the current FIFA rankings show Rwanda sit a lowly 133rd in the world having been as high as 64th in the spring of 2015. They are a team never expected to make an impact in any major international tournament but have shown in the past by causing their share of upset wins that they shouldn’t be taken lightly.

Rwanda have appeared in this competition only once previously when qualifying in 2004 but they failed to make an impact, knocked out at the earliest opportunity in the group stages. Qualifying was a source of pride that year, but fans will want to see better from the team here.
